Hi Valdis,

Normally the name will indicate the physical location of the disk.

So the name of the disk you have listed is  "e2d3s11" this is Enclosure 2
Disk shelf 3 Disk slot 11.  However, based on the location = "" this is the
reason for the failure of the tscommand failure. Normally a recovery group
rebuild fixes the issue from what I have seen in the past.

> dear all,
>
> I want to understand how GNR/GSS/ESS stores information about the pdisk
> location
> I looked in the configuration file
>
> /var/mmfs/gen/mmfsNodeData
> /var/mmfs/gen/mmsdrfs
> /var/mmfs/gen/mmfs.cfg
>
> but no location of pdisk
>
> this is real scenario of unknown location
> this is the output from GNR/GSS/ESS
> -----------------------------------
> [root at ess1 ~]# mmlspdisk BB1RGR --not-ok
> pdisk:
> replacementPriority = 2.00
> name = "e2d3s11"
> device = ""
> recoveryGroup = "BB1RGR"
> declusteredArray = "DA2"
> state = "missing/noPath/systemDrain/noRGD/noVCD/noData"
> capacity  = 3000034656256
> freeSpace = 2997887172608
> location = ""
> WWN = "naa.5000C50056717727"
> server = "ess1-ib0"
> reads = 106800946
> writes = 10414075
> IOErrors = 1216
> IOTimeouts = 18
> mediaErrors = 0
> checksumErrors = 0
> pathErrors = 0
> relativePerformance = 1.000
> userLocation = ""
> userCondition = "replaceable"
> hardware = "   "
> hardwareType = Rotating 7200
> nPaths = 0 active 0 total
> nsdFormatVersion = Unknown
> paxosAreaOffset = Unknown
> paxosAreaSize = Unknown
> logicalBlockSize = 512
> -----------------------------------
> I begin change the Hard disk
> mmchcarrier BB1RGR --release --pdisk "e2d3s11"
> I have this error
> Location of pdisk e2d3s11 of recovery group BB1RGR is not known.
> i know the location of the Hard disk
> i know the location of the Hard disk from old mmlspdisk file
> mmchcarrier BB1RGR --release --pdisk "e2d3s11" --location "SV30708502-3-11"
>
> Location of pdisk e2d3s11 of recovery group BB1RGR is not known.
> I read in the official documentation
> 6027-3001 [E] Location of pdisk pdiskName of recovery
> group recoveryGroupName is not known.
> Explanation: IBM Spectrum Scale is unable to find the
> location of the given pdisk.
> User response: Check the disk enclosure hardware.
